What savings can I expect?
A standard long-haul business class ticket typically costs €3,500 to €4,000 (£3,000 to £3,400). Our fares usually range between €1,250 and €2,000 (£1,050 to £1,700). We look for mistake fares and empty-seat promotions that can save you up to 70%.
Are these last-minute fares?
Rarely. While we do find last-minute options occasionally, most fares have availability 2 to 10 months ahead. You get time to plan a proper trip.
